Output 85f58aed089cbf53e8f76280c860611fa143ba27345511dda64892855c1a7200:8

value
659431
script pubkey
OP_0 OP_PUSHBYTES_20 528148e6b8c3ba8d30dcf6b8f946d5ece63ebcdd
address
bc1q22q53e4ccwag6vxu76u0j3k4annra0xa6rk8jg
transaction
85f58aed089cbf53e8f76280c860611fa143ba27345511dda64892855c1a7200
spent
true